Buckeye Partners is currently seeking a Manager, Operational Technologywith OT experience as it relates to analysis, design, and application management in the Oil & Gas Industry to join our growing team!
Role Summary:
The Manager, Operational Technology role is responsible for the Vendor & Application management of a portfolio of applications within the OT area. This will include but not limited to implementation of departmental process improvement changes, oversight and collaborative management of the Operational Technology Domain, and leading cross-functional department projects.

Position Requirements
  • Degree - Desired - Management Informational Systems, Computer Science or Business
  • 1-3 Years of supervisory experience leading teams or demonstrated leadership abilities and related experience.
  • 5+ Years of progressive experience in Operational Technology: Automatioon, Process Control, DCS and applicable OT Domain.
  • Experience in the following is preferred: Toptech TMS, mySQL, IBM DB2, Microsoft SQL, Programmable Logic Controllers, Human Machine Interface, Operator Interface Panel, Refined Petroleum Load Rack Controllers (MultiLoad, AccuLoad), Client Server technologies and browser-based applications.
  • Ability to travel up to 25% both domestically and internationally.

Buckeye Partners is the logistical solutions partner of choice for the global energy business. As one of the nation's largest independent petroleum products common carrier pipeline network providers, Buckeye Partners L.P. provides terminals, storage, and refined product distribution services; our strength is to create centers of expertise around our products, technologies and client needs.
Buckeye Partners, L.P. headquartered in Houston, Texas is one of the primary distributors of petroleum in the eastern and mid-western portions of the United States.
